Block #20,626,640
Block Hash
df0878604260e46d17ace2c89f9c8816af759fdb1a9b2a97b7b955089850f2cb
Merkle root
a7b69708ddcd32420acb346ead754d04443474e19065748f9a3bb64dccf8711a
Time
2025-01-03 17:35:21
Transactions
1
Height (Confirmations)
20,626,640 (10,960)
Block Size
198 bytes
Algorithm
odo
Nonce
2559949504
Bits
1a20fb2a
Difficulty
508683.9161488815